GREEN COFFEE INVENTORY · ROAST BATCH
OLLA keeps lightweight inventory inside Roast Lab: a green lot can retain physical data, defect weighting, and Lot Status; charging a batch deducts its green stock, dropping the roast records roasted weight, and the same batch can continue into bean cards, cupping, and brewing.

GREEN LOT RECORD
OLLA structures lightweight inventory around coffee lots rather than one anonymous stock total. The green record can retain physical data, weighted defects, and lot status so later batch consumption still knows which raw material it came from.
BATCH CONSUMPTION
Inventory changes when roasting happens. The charge weight recorded on the roast timeline is linked to its green lot and deducted from that inventory, keeping stock balance and production history on the same source of truth.
ROASTED OUTPUT
Enter the actual roasted weight after the batch so green input and roasted output remain together. The batch can retain results such as weight loss and then become a bean card for the next stages of the coffee's history.
STOCK REPORT · LOCAL FIRST
OLLA's export set includes a lightweight inventory report for archiving or sharing current stock context alongside roast work. The app remains local-first: records are stored on the device by default, with iCloud sync left to the user.
